A 25-year-old man who is said to be responsible for bombing the fertility clinic in Palm Springs, CaliforniaHe was allegedly a self-proclaimed “pro-Morrtalist” and believed that people should not be entered into the world without their own consent.
Guy Edward Bartkes – who was from Twentynine Palms – allegedly started car bomb On Saturday near the Navigation Center clinic, killing and injuring four more.
Bartkes allegedly wrote in writings and recordings that he opposed the idea of bringing people into the world against their will, Kcal News reported, quoting Two sources for the implementation of the law familiar with the investigation.
The records he left behind were “Anti-Pro-Life”, American lawyer Bilal “Bill” Essayli said on X.

“This was Targeted attack Against the IVF facility, “Akil Davis, Assistant Director in charge of FBI Los Angeles FBI, at a press conference on Sunday.” Don’t go wrong, we treat it, as I said yesterday, as a deliberate terrorist act. “
FBI They described Bartkus as a “nihilist idea,” and noted that he might have tried to take a lifetime bombing on social networks. The authorities also study the possible manifesto that Bartke wrote as part of his investigation, Davis said.

“Based on our investigation, some of the posts he set online, some of the comments in his manifesto we currently break through – this is a kind of what led us to that nihilist belief,” Davis said.
The car bombing happened just before 11am on Saturday on the northern Indian canyon driving near the Eastern Tacha’s driving, according to City officials. The explosion damaged a nearby company and residential real estate, and the pieces of Bartkas’s car threw hundreds of meters into the air and several blocks, towards the authorities.

Bartke was driving a Silver Ford Fusion sedan from 2010 with a 8HWS848 license plate. Officials believe that they are aware of when he entered Palm Springs, but seek to help the public know where he was in the city before the attack.
The FBI said Bartke was not on their radar before bombing. No criminal files, bankruptcy or Sexual offenses were immediately found in public records Bartkas by Fox News Digital.

Bartkes was a resident of Twentynine Palms, a city in San Bernardino County, located about 60 miles from the Palm Springs. The city serves as the entrance point of the Mojave Desert and Joshua Tree National Park.

“This is probably the biggest bombing scene we had in southern California,” Davis said.
US Reproductive Centers claim that the first and only center for the fertility of the full service and the in vitro Laboratory for fertilization in the Coachella Valley is said on his website. While the building was damaged, the IVF lab and its materials remained unharmed.
